Aetna Select Health Plan

The Aetna Select Plan provides quality care for a low out-of-pocket cost.

The plan has no deductible and no coinsurance for most services. You pay a low flat fee (called a copay) for most covered services. Aetna's extensive nationwide Aetna Select provider network has approximately 519,000* primary care physicians, specialists, hospitals, and other health care providers across the United States. This means you and your family have access to a full range of medical services almost anywhere you live, work or travel. Your Aetna Select Plan also offers several unique special programs  that focus on specific health needs and conditions providing information, guidance and discounts that complement our standard medical coverage. One such program is Healthy Outlook, Aetna's disease management program for members diagnosed with diabetes, asthma or congestive heart disease. Healthy Outlook provides information and support to help you manage your condition, avoid complications and enjoy better overall health.

With an emphasis placed on wellness, the Aetna Select plan covers preventive care at 100 percent. We also offer a full range of online and telephone services designed to keep you and your family healthy.

There are never any claims to file or balances to pay if you utilize the Aetna Select network. Instead you pay a flat copay amount for most eligible services. Your primary care physician (PCP) will handle any precertification required for certain types of care.

Your PCP and Network Providers

When you enroll in the plan, you select a primary care physician (PCP) for yourself and each covered family member from Aetna's network of participating providers. You may choose a different PCP for each member of your family. A PCP can be a general practitioner, family practitioner, internist or pediatrician. You can change your PCP at any time.

Your PCP will:

  • Provide routine and preventive care.
  • Treat you for illnesses and injuries.
  • Help you make important medical decisions.
  • Help you find a participating network specialist when you need one.

If you need Ob/GYN or chiropractic care, you may make an appointment directly with any network Ob/GYN or chiropractor, without a referral from your PCP. For all other types of specialty care, you'll need a referral from your PCP.

How Benefits Are Paid

Benefits for covered services are paid only when your care is provided or coordinated by your PCP. You pay a low flat fee, or copay, for most services. Preventive care (such as immunizations and health screenings) and certain other services are covered at 100 percent, up to your plan maximums. There is no need to file a claim for benefits. When you visit your PCP or a network provider, simply show your Aetna ID card and pay the copay.
